Is the Certified Penetration Testing Professional (CPENT) Worth It? Honest Review & ROI Analysis
Deciding whether to pursue the Certified Penetration Testing Professional (CPENT) certification involves weighing its technical depth, practical application, and potential career benefits against its cost and time commitment. For cybersecurity professionals aiming to advance their penetration testing skills, the CPENT presents itself as a hands-on, expert-level credential. This analysis explores its value, comparing it to alternatives, examining its impact on career trajectories, and assessing the return on investment (ROI) for prospective candidates.
CPENT Overview: What Makes It Different?
The CPENT, offered by EC-Council, positions itself as an advanced, practical penetration testing certification. Unlike some certifications that rely heavily on multiple-choice questions, CPENT emphasizes a 24-hour, proctored, hands-on exam environment designed to simulate real-world penetration testing scenarios. This approach aims to validate a candidate's ability to not just recall theoretical knowledge but to apply it effectively under pressure.
The curriculum covers a broad range of advanced topics, including:
- Advanced Windows and Linux Exploitation: Moving beyond basic privilege escalation to more complex techniques.
- IoT and OT Penetration Testing: Addressing the growing attack surface of interconnected devices and operational technologies.
- Binary Exploitation: Understanding and exploiting software vulnerabilities at a deeper level.
- Advanced Web Application Penetration Testing: Delving into modern web application vulnerabilities and complex bypasses.
- Double Pivoting and Lateral Movement: Simulating sophisticated network attacks that involve multiple hops and compromised systems.
- Bypassing Security Controls: Techniques to circumvent firewalls, IDS/IPS, and other defensive mechanisms.
The focus on practical application is a key differentiator. Candidates are expected to demonstrate proficiency in identifying vulnerabilities, exploiting them, and then documenting their findings, much like a professional penetration tester would in an engagement. This practical emphasis is often cited by those who value the certification as a true test of skill.
CPENT vs. OSCP: A Common Comparison
When discussing advanced penetration testing certifications, the Offensive Security Certified Professional (OSCP) frequently comes up as a point of comparison. Both are highly respected, hands-on certifications, but they cater to slightly different skill levels and cover some distinct areas.
The OSCP, offered by Offensive Security, is widely regarded as an entry-to-intermediate level hands-on penetration testing certification. It focuses heavily on foundational exploitation techniques, network penetration, and report writing. Many professionals consider the OSCP a benchmark for demonstrating fundamental penetration testing skills.
The CPENT, on the other hand, aims for a more advanced scope. While it builds upon foundational knowledge, it delves into areas like advanced exploitation, IoT/OT, and bypassing sophisticated defenses that the OSCP typically doesn't cover in as much depth. The 24-hour exam format for CPENT, often split into two 12-hour segments, also differs from OSCP's single 24-hour exam.
Key Differences Between CPENT and OSCP
| Feature |
CPENT |
OSCP |
| Provider |
EC-Council |
Offensive Security |
| Skill Level |
Advanced |
Entry-to-Intermediate |
| Exam Format |
24 hours (often split into two 12-hour sessions) |
24 hours (single session) |
| Primary Focus |
Advanced exploitation, IoT/OT, binary exploitation, double pivoting, advanced web app, bypassing security controls |
Foundational exploitation, network services, basic web app, privilege escalation, report writing |
| Prerequisites |
Recommended: CEH or equivalent knowledge |
Strong Linux fundamentals, networking basics |
| Recognition |
Growing, particularly in specific sectors |
Widely recognized as an industry standard for entry-level pen testing |
| Learning Style |
Structured courseware, labs, range access |
Self-study with extensive lab environment |
For someone new to hands-on penetration testing, the OSCP is often recommended as a starting point. For those who have already attained the OSCP or possess equivalent practical experience and are looking to push their skills into more specialized and complex domains, the CPENT can be a logical next step. It's not necessarily a question of which is "better," but rather which aligns more closely with a professional's current skill level and career aspirations.
Career Value and Salary Increase Potential
The primary motivation for pursuing a certification like CPENT is often career advancement and increased earning potential. While specific salary increases are difficult to quantify precisely due to numerous variables (location, experience, company size, existing skillset), the CPENT aims to validate skills that are in high demand.
Penetration testers with advanced capabilities, especially in areas like IoT, OT, and binary exploitation, are sought after in various industries. Companies, particularly those with complex IT infrastructures or critical operational technologies, require professionals who can identify and mitigate sophisticated threats.
Potential Career Impact of CPENT
- Specialized Roles: Opens doors to roles focusing on advanced penetration testing, red teaming, and vulnerability research.
- Consulting Opportunities: Enhances credibility for independent consultants or those working for cybersecurity consulting firms.
- Leadership Positions: Demonstrates a commitment to advanced skill development, potentially leading to senior or lead penetration tester roles.
- Increased Earning Potential: While not guaranteed, the specialized skills validated by CPENT can command higher salaries. According to various salary aggregators (e.g., Glassdoor, Indeed, Payscale), the average salary for penetration testers can range widely, from $80,000 to over $150,000 annually, with senior roles and specialized skills pushing towards the higher end. A certification like CPENT, coupled with experience, can contribute to moving up this scale.
It's important to frame salary expectations realistically. A certification alone rarely guarantees a dramatic salary bump; rather, it acts as a strong signal to employers that an individual possesses a certain validated skill set. The actual increase depends on how effectively individuals can leverage these skills in their current or prospective roles.
EC-Council's CPENT Review – What You Need to Know
A comprehensive review of CPENT involves looking at the training, the exam experience, and the overall perception within the cybersecurity community.
Training and Labs
EC-Council provides official training for CPENT, which typically includes:
- Instructor-led training: Often delivered virtually or in person, covering the course modules.
- Self-paced learning materials: E-courseware, video lectures, and study guides.
- Hands-on lab environment (iLabs): This is a critical component, offering access to virtual machines and networks designed to practice the techniques taught in the course. The iLabs are generally well-regarded for their realism and the breadth of scenarios they cover. They are crucial for preparing for the practical exam.
The quality of training can vary depending on the instructor for live sessions, but the core materials and labs are designed to be comprehensive. Many candidates report spending significant time in the labs, often beyond the officially allocated hours, to master the required skills.
The Exam Experience
The CPENT exam is a 24-hour practical assessment, typically split into two 12-hour segments. This structure allows candidates a break to rest and strategize, which is a common point of appreciation compared to a continuous 24-hour exam.
The exam environment is designed to mimic a corporate network with various operating systems, applications, and security controls. Candidates are presented with specific objectives, such as gaining root access, exfiltrating data, or exploiting specific vulnerabilities. Success hinges on a methodical approach, strong problem-solving skills, and the ability to adapt to unexpected challenges.
Common feedback on the exam includes:
- Realism: Many find the scenarios to be genuinely reflective of real-world penetration tests.
- Difficulty: It's considered a challenging exam, requiring deep technical knowledge and practical experience. It's not a certification for beginners.
- Scope: The exam covers a wide range of topics, meaning candidates need to be proficient across multiple domains.
- Documentation: Candidates must not only exploit vulnerabilities but also document their steps and findings, including screenshots and explanations, which is part of the grading criteria.
EC-Council's Reputation and Perception
EC-Council, as a certification body, has faced scrutiny and debate within the cybersecurity community, particularly concerning its Certified Ethical Hacker (CEH) certification. However, certifications like CPENT and EC-Council's more advanced offerings are generally viewed more favorably due to their hands-on, practical nature.
While the "EC-Council" name might carry some baggage for a segment of the community, the CPENT itself tends to be evaluated on its own merits: its rigorous exam and the advanced skills it validates. Employers often look for substantiated skills rather than just brand names, and the practical nature of CPENT helps in this regard.
EC-Council Certified Penetration Testing Professional (CPENT) Difficulty
The CPENT is widely considered a difficult certification, and rightly so. Its difficulty stems from several factors:
- Breadth of Topics: The curriculum spans a wide array of advanced penetration testing domains, requiring expertise in areas that might be specialized for many professionals. This includes advanced web exploitation, binary exploitation, IoT, OT, cloud, and sophisticated network attacks.
- Depth of Knowledge: It's not enough to know about these topics; candidates must demonstrate the ability to perform complex attacks and bypass various security controls. This often requires understanding underlying protocols, programming concepts, and system internals.
- Practical, Hands-on Exam: The 24-hour exam demands sustained focus, problem-solving under pressure, and the ability to troubleshoot issues in a live environment. There are no multiple-choice questions to lean on; every point must be earned through successful exploitation and documentation.
- Time Management: Successfully navigating the exam requires efficient time management. Candidates must prioritize tasks, avoid rabbit holes, and know when to switch tactics.
- Report Writing: The requirement to document findings during the exam adds another layer of complexity, demanding clear communication alongside technical prowess.
Who is CPENT for?
Given its difficulty, CPENT is best suited for:
- Experienced Penetration Testers: Individuals who already have foundational penetration testing skills, possibly holding certifications like OSCP, GPEN, or equivalent experience.
- Red Teamers: Professionals involved in advanced simulated attacks and adversary emulation.
- Vulnerability Researchers: Those who delve deep into identifying and exploiting software and system vulnerabilities.
- Security Consultants: Professionals who need to demonstrate advanced capabilities to clients.
- Cybersecurity Professionals looking to specialize: Individuals seeking to move beyond general cybersecurity roles into highly technical penetration testing or offensive security.
It is generally not recommended for individuals new to cybersecurity or even those new to hands-on penetration testing. Building a solid foundation before tackling CPENT will significantly increase the chances of success and the overall learning experience.
Return on Investment (ROI) Analysis
Evaluating the ROI for CPENT involves considering the financial costs, time investment, and potential benefits.
Costs Involved
| Item |
Estimated Cost (USD) |
Notes |
| Course Fee |
$2,000 - $3,500+ |
Varies based on provider, whether it's self-paced, instructor-led, or part of a bundle. Includes e-courseware and iLabs access. |
| Exam Voucher |
$600 - $1,000+ |
Can be included in course bundles or purchased separately. Retake fees apply if needed. |
| Study Materials |
$0 - $500 |
Books, additional lab environments, practice platforms. |
| Time Investment |
200 - 500+ hours |
Significant personal time dedicated to studying, practicing in labs, and preparing for the exam. This is a non-monetary cost but crucial. |
| Lost Wages |
Variable |
If taking time off work for training or intense study, this is a factor. |
| Total Monetary Cost |
$2,600 - $5,000+ |
This is a rough estimate and can vary significantly. |
Potential Benefits
- Skill Validation: A strong, practical validation of advanced penetration testing skills.
- Career Advancement: Potential for promotion to senior roles, specialized positions, or red team engagements.
- Increased Earning Potential: Access to higher-paying jobs due to specialized and in-demand skills.
- Enhanced Credibility: Demonstrates a commitment to continuous learning and mastery in offensive security.
- Networking Opportunities: Engaging with other professionals through training and community discussions.
Calculating ROI
A direct financial ROI calculation is challenging due to the variability of salary increases and career paths. However, a qualitative ROI can be assessed:
- High ROI: If the certification directly leads to a promotion, a significant salary increase, or a move into a highly desired specialized role that would otherwise be inaccessible, the ROI is likely high. This is especially true for individuals who leverage the skills immediately in their careers.
- Moderate ROI: If the certification enhances current job performance, provides valuable skills, but doesn't immediately translate to a large financial gain or promotion, the ROI is still positive but more long-term. The skills gained can build a foundation for future opportunities.
- Low ROI: If the skills gained are not directly applicable to one's current or desired role, or if the individual struggles to pass the exam, the ROI might be low. This underscores the importance of aligning the certification with career goals and having adequate preparation.
For experienced professionals looking to validate and expand their advanced penetration testing capabilities, the CPENT often represents a solid investment. The practical nature of the exam ensures that those who pass genuinely possess the skills, which is a strong selling point to employers.
Conclusion
Is the Certified Penetration Testing Professional (CPENT) worth it? For the right candidate – an experienced cybersecurity professional with a solid foundation in penetration testing who is looking to specialize in advanced exploitation, IoT/OT security, or red teaming – the answer is often yes.
The CPENT offers a rigorous, hands-on validation of advanced skills that are in high demand across various industries. While the monetary and time investment is significant, the potential for career advancement, increased earning potential, and the acquisition of highly specialized knowledge can provide a strong return.
However, it is not a stepping stone for beginners. Those considering CPENT should honestly assess their current skill set, career aspirations, and willingness to commit substantial time and effort to master the challenging material. For those ready to take on its demands, the CPENT can be a valuable credential that distinguishes them in a competitive cybersecurity landscape.